Ashley Madison, an internet site helping a�?cheating spouses line up a fling onlinea�?, has-been compromised by a bunch called The results staff, and that has confronted to share consumer facts online when the site seriously is not close.

AshleyMadison

is owned by serious being mass media (ALM), a Toronto-based fast. ALM also possess some other dating sites like Cougar Daily life and conventional Guy. AshleyMadison ‘s been around since 2001 and states have over 37 million individuals.

Why have AshleyMadison have compromised? According to the hackers, an element of exactly why appears to be $20 charge that AshleyMadison would charge its individuals as long as they hoped for their unique profile deleted absolutely. The hackers, that pennyless into web site, revealed about the reports of actually folks that have spent the cost was still quite gift.

The hackers in addition leaked charts of interior providers hosts, worker internet account information, organization bank account info and earnings know-how. The effects organization in addition has implicated ALM of operating a prostitution band employing the web site also known as Established Males which is designed to connect wealthy guy with attractive teenagers.

On billing $20 to get rid of an account, Ashley Madison has confronted concerns this over the years. Ars Technica, experienced before mentioned the AshleyMadison internet site was actually perplexing customers if it concerned deleting profile.

The review revealed exactly how people were provided suggestions like cover account (which induced the profile becoming invisible and a fundamental deactivation) and Comprehensive erase which noticed full disposal of facts, emails, personal background, etc from your site. To accomplish one erase, users had to pay up, while a�?hide profilea�� wouldn’t actually demonstrate what happened any time people went regarding alternative.

Your data breach atAshleyMadison arrives 2 months after dating internet site AdultFriendFinder was actually hacked adding the information of virtually 4 million people in danger the way it got determine the means on the web. AdultFriendFinder did not unveil the character on the data safety violation together with announced it has been investigating the incident with police force businesses.

Unlike in the case of XxxbuddyFriender, a�?Ashley Madisona�? online criminals need help with a very clear interest that ALM shutdown the web sites. That individual facts was actually affected and so the online criminals allegations that ALM does not get rid of bank card help and advice and that’s linked to other things like address and title, stresses convenience questions. The event is yet another demonstration of exactly how businesses usually tend to treat individual info together with the absence of visibility that needs to change, even in the event actually around older people who happen to be prospective cheaters.
